How an MVP project works
From idea to working product – step by step
Discuss the idea
Free initial consultation: What is your vision? What core features does the MVP need? Who are the users?
Define the MVP
Together we define the minimum feature set – only what is truly needed to validate the idea.
Development
I build the prototype in 1–2 weeks. You get regular updates and can give feedback directly.
Launch & iterate
The MVP goes live. Based on real user feedback we continue developing – iteratively and focused.
